Can I suggest adding the package "cupsys-driver-gimpprint" to 'main'
and making it a core ubuntu package (gimp-print is already in 'main')
?

It really adds support for a LOT of very common printers to ubuntu's
gnome-cups-manager, and may help many people whose printer would not
otherwise appear in the list. Furthermore, the package is not an
intuitive one for a new user to add if their printer is not listed
without it.
